Mega Moolah progressive jackpot reaches $5.5m

Online casino software developer Microgaming’s Mega Moolah Progressive Jackpot officially hit the $5.5 million mark this week and it is expected to burst at any time.

The progressive jackpot is fast approaching the record $8.7 million total that was dropped back in 2009 and punters are hoping for an early Christmas present with the jackpot anticipated to be hit at any moment.

The average win on Mega Moolah comes just over every 12 weeks and the jackpot was last hit 4 months and 13 days ago back when summer was still in the air and the London 2012 Olympics were still fresh in the memory.

Mega Moolah is a 5 reel, 25 pay-line slot game that has an African safari theme where players will experience a true African vibe whilst trying to win millions of dollars on the progressive jackpot.

Symbols in Mega Moolah include various safari animals such as lions, giraffes, elephants and monkeys. The wild symbol is represented by the lion and the scatter symbol is represented by the monkeys.

The main bonus feature in Mega Moolah is the Mega Moolah Free Spins Bonus Round where the player wins 15 free spins with a 3x multiplier if they hit three or more of the scatter symbols across the reels.
